INVITATION TO APPLY FOR ELIGIBILITY AND TO BID

The Philippine Reclamation Authority (PRA), through its Bids and Awards Committee (BAC), invites suppliers to apply for eligibility and to bid for the Supply and Delivery of Purified Drinking Water:

Name of Project: SUPPLY AND DELIVERY OF PURIFIED DRINKING WATER
Project ID No.
GOODS 09-007
Location
7th Floor, Legaspi Towers 200, Paseo de Roxas, Makati City
Brief Description Supply and delivery of purified drinking water including free-use of seven (7) hot and cold water dispensers for PRA Offices.
Approved Budget For the Contract: Php 146,000.00
Contract Period One (1) year
Delivery Period Immediately upon signing of contract

Prospective bidders should have experience in undertaking a similar project within the last two (2) years with an amount of at least 50% of the ABC. The Eligibility Check/Screening as well as the Preliminary Examination of Bids shall use non-discretionary “pass/fail” criteria. All Bids must be accompanied by a Bid Security in the form stipulated in the Bid Documents. Late Bids shall not be accepted. Post-qualification of the lowest calculated bid shall be conducted.

All particulars relative to Eligibility Statement and Screening, Bid Security, Performance Security, Pre-Bidding Conference(s), Evaluation of Bids, Post-Qualification and Award of Contract shall be governed by the pertinent provisions of R.A. 9184 and its Implementing Rules and Regulation (IRR).
